Amazing what a rivalry week will do. Lots of energy on display.
Ross Cockrell channeled his inner Ozzie. "Our goal this week is to ring the bell and shock the world. It's our season. It's our bowl game."
Most poignant moment? Matt Daniels was talking to about a half-dozen of us. The subject was the impact of a Duke win over Carolina. He said something like " a win would be so big for us going into next season. Then, he paused and laughed; "I guess I mean for them."
That's what happens with seniors at the end of their final season. It just kind of sneaks up on them.
Daniels had another interesting comment. "This game means so much to the Duke community. Our fans want it even more than I want it, and I want it pretty bad."
So, yes, they do know you're out there.
Daniels added that Duke had great schemes for this week but seemed to focus on the more primal aspects of the game. "We need to big-boy-up. From the very first play, we need to send the message that we aren't going to be pushed around."
Cut acknowledged that Duke is "not as healthy as we'd like to be." Still, Duke had a pretty physical practice this A.M., with lots of 1st-team v. 1st-team work.
Emphasis on being prepared "to go toe-to-toe." No secret that Carolina has tried to physically bully Duke in recent years and Duke seems to have had enough. Is Duke healthy enough for it to matter?
Cut also acknowledged that he and Roper spent a lot of time going into the GT game working on improving the redzone schemes and performance. Maybe, a corner turned.
Speaking of Matt Daniels, Cut has argued for much of the season that he deserved to be a first-team All-America. Cut is trying real hard to get Daniels an invite to the NFL combine. Much praise for Daniels' consistency. Never takes a play off, never takes a practice off. Great work ethic. Duke will miss him.
